Dolbenmaen, Penmorfa and Llanfihangel-y-Pennant deeds : : townships of Penyfed and Pennant,

Title deeds, 1427-1528, for properties in the townships of Penyfed and Pennant, which came within the boundaries of three parishes, Dolbenmaen, Penmorfa and, Llanfihangel-y-Pennant. The properties include Braich y Dinas, acquired as 'tir prid' by John ap Meredudd, 1475; lands acquired by Moris ap John ap Meredudd, 1483-1513, including the original gift of Clenennau, 1500-1501, other parts of Clenennau, 1508-1509, and Cae Pedere, 1505, 1507, 1511, 1513; and properties gained by Eliza ap Moris, 1514-1528, including lands in Clenennau, purchased from Bedo ap Madog ap Yngko in 1514, and Llaeth Fynydd, 1528.

Dolbenmaen, Penmorfa and Llanfihangel-y-Pennant deeds : : townships of Penyfed and Pennant

Title deeds, 1529-1629, for properties in the townships of Penyfed and Pennant, which came within the boundaries of three parishes, Dolbenmaen, Penmorfa and, Llanfihangel-y-Pennant. They include lands acquired by Eliza ap Moris, 1529-1555, including Braich y Dinas and parts of Clenennau, 1529, 1532-1533, 1546, and Tyddyn Mawr yn y Pennant, 1533, 1536; lands gained by Moris ap Eliza, 1575, William Maurice, 1580-1586, whose acquisitions included a demise of crown land in the Forest of Snowdon, 1581, Dame Ellen Eure, 1623-1624, and John Owen, 1628-1629. Includes a deed of sale by Eliza ap Moris to John ap David ap Rees, of Tyddyn Du, 1556, which was later sold to Ellis ap Robert Wynn of Sylfaen.

Deeds and documents,

Miscellaneous deeds and documents, 1323-1597/1598, relating to properties in Llanfrothen and Llandecwyn, co. Merioneth, the commote of Penllyn, co. Merioneth, Clynnog Fechan and Llanfair, co. Anglesey, the commotes of Dunlley and Uchor', co. Caernarfon. Most of the deeds relate to properties within the parish of Llanfrothen. There is also a licence, 1483/1484, to buy tenements in the parish of Pennant in the commote of Eifionnydd, co. Caernarfon.
